摘 要:在我国智能制造技术的发展及战略部署背景下,其产业链需求对高职智能制造专业人才培养模式提出更高要求。武汉船院的智能装备制造与应用专业群,注重各专业的交叉融合性,培养具有交叉优势的复合型人才,配套建设智能制造生产线、确定人才培养模式新方向,执行创新能力培育,实现专业群学生的个性化培养目标。With the development and strategic deployment of intelligent manufacturing technology in China, the demand of the industrial chain has put forward higher requirements for intelligent manufacturing talent training. Taking Wuhan Institute of Shipbuilding Technology as an example, this essay discussed an integrated talent training program for Intelligent Equipment Manufacturing and Application specialty group including measures like training the comprehensive ability of students though the integration of the specialty group, building an intelligent and automated production line for student skills training, determining the talent training mode, carrying out innovation ability training and individualized skills training of students in the specialty group.
